Unexpected token gulp?

Ошибка "Unexpected token gulp" возникает, когда происходит попытка выполнить файл, содержащий синтаксическую ошибку на ключевом слове "gulp". Эта ошибка может возникать по нескольким причинам, таким как неправильная установка Gulp.js, неправильное использование его API или конфликт версий Node.js и Gulp.js. Перед тем как переходить к решению проблемы, убедитесь, что у вас установлены Node.js и Gulp.js. Если ... Читать далее

Где ошибка в сборке gulp?

Чтобы найти ошибку в сборке Gulp.js, необходимо провести анализ кода и процесса сборки. Вот несколько шагов, которые можно выполнить: 1. Проверьте файлы конфигурации: - Убедитесь, что файл gulpfile.js содержит правильные задачи и корректные зависимости. - Проверьте файл package.json и убедитесь, что все зависимости Gulp.js и плагины установлены и имеют корректные версии. 2. Проверьте наличие ошибок ... Читать далее

Как в gulp упростить написание путей?

В Gulp.js есть несколько способов упростить написание путей для файлов, чтобы улучшить читаемость и поддерживаемость сборки проекта. 1. Использование переменных: При написании путей можно использовать переменные для хранения длинных или часто используемых путей. Например: const paths = { src: 'src', dist: 'dist', js: { src: 'src/js', dist: 'dist/js' }, css: { src: 'src/css', dist: 'dist/css' ... Читать далее

Ошибка в Gulp, как решить?

Ошибки в Gulp могут возникать по разным причинам, и решение проблемы зависит от конкретной ошибки. В этом ответе я рассмотрю несколько распространенных ошибок в Gulp и предоставлю возможные способы их решения. 1. Ошибка: "gulp: command not found". Эта ошибка возникает, когда Gulp не установлен глобально на вашем компьютере. Чтобы решить эту проблему, вы можете установить ... Читать далее

В Gulp 3 происходит зацикливание при сборке когда одновременно выполняется проверка SCSS и CSS файлов?

В версии 3.x Gulp.js действительно может возникнуть проблема зацикливания при одновременной сборке SCSS и CSS файлов. Это происходит из-за особенностей последовательности выполнения задач в Gulp. При запуске Gulp.js вам может понадобиться создать несколько задач, например, для компиляции SCSS в CSS и для минификации CSS файлов. Вы можете определить эти задачи следующим образом: const gulp = ... Читать далее

Как сделать условие для активных меню в gulp-file-include?

Для создания условия для активных меню в gulp-file-include вам потребуется использовать три вещи: переменные, шаблоны и операторы условий. Шаблоны Первым шагом вам нужно создать шаблонный файл, который будет содержать ваше меню. Например, вам нужно создать файл menu.html, в котором будет разметка вашего меню. <ul> <li><a href="/home">Home</a></li> <li><a href="/about">About</a></li> <li><a href="/contact">Contact</a></li> <!-- Добавьте дополнительные ссылки меню, ... Читать далее

Почему gulp не видит шрифты?

Если Gulp не видит шрифты, это может быть вызвано несколькими причинами. Давайте их рассмотрим подробнее: 1. Неправильно настроенная конфигурация Gulp: Убедитесь, что вы правильно настроили задачу Gulp для копирования шрифтов. Проверьте, что вы указали правильные пути для копирования исходных файлов шрифтов в целевую папку сборки. 2. Ошибки в путях к шрифтам: Проверьте, что пути к ... Читать далее

Как из модуля JS получит JSON в Gulp?

Для того чтобы получить JSON данные из модуля JavaScript в Gulp, нам понадобится использовать соответствующий плагин или модуль для обработки JSON файлов. Для начала, вам потребуется установить плагин gulp-json с помощью следующей команды: npm install --save-dev gulp-json Следующим шагом, вам необходимо подключить этот плагин в вашем Gulp файле: const gulp = require('gulp'); const json = ... Читать далее

Как в Gulp/SASS указать стиль шрифта к элементу @mixin @font-face?

В Gulp.js и SASS вы можете использовать @mixin для определения стиля шрифта в блоке @font-face. Это позволяет вам легко переиспользовать свойства шрифта в разных местах вашего проекта. Вот пример использования @mixin для стиля шрифта в блоке @font-face: 1. Создайте файл SASS с именем fonts.scss (или любым другим именем, которое вам нравится) и определите в нем ... Читать далее

Как правильно настроиться babel в gulp чтобы срабатывали полифилы (и другие вопросы)?

Настраивая Babel в Gulp для работы с полифилами и другими возможностями требует нескольких шагов. Вот подробное объяснение процесса: Шаг 1: Установка Babel и дополнительных пакетов Первым шагом является установка Babel и дополнительных пакетов, которые позволят вам использовать полифилы и другие возможности. Установите следующие npm-пакеты с помощью команды npm install: npm install --save-dev gulp-babel @babel/core @babel/preset-env ... Читать далее